There is some really cool work going on here. Derrick OP is being used to remove 483's sand dome so 483 can get a staybolt cap and lagging inspection. At this time there was no crane of any kind on the property. The other thing is 487 is hot. 487's flue time expired in the fall of 1967 and had not run since. Here we see her with the tender lettering blacked out doing the switching work. 487 did not go into service on the C&TS until 1974. 484 also needed a flue extension to be placed in service that spring.

Rich and the gang accomplished a lot of work with absolutely nothing to work with.
